Raybern’s expands heat-and-eat sandwich line with sliders

Raybern’s is expanding beyond full-size frozen sandwiches with a smaller format aimed at convenience, sharing and everyday meal occasions.

Raybern’s has launched a new line of frozen sliders. Its expanded heat-and-eat sandwich lineup includes Cheeseburger Smashed Sliders, Birria Sliders and Ham & Swiss Sliders.

  • Cheeseburger Smashed Sliders include a grilled Angus beef patty with American cheese.
  • Birria Sliders include seasoned pork with chili spices and American cheese.
  • Ham & Swiss Sliders pair ham and Swiss cheese on a Hawaiian roll.

Designed for quick meals and snacks, each slider reportedly has 9 g of protein and is ready in minutes. Each package contains a pair of two-slider packs, or four sliders.

The launch moves Raybern’s beyond its full-size frozen sandwiches into a smaller format. The company said the sliders use bakery-soft bread and chef-crafted flavors intended for lunches, snacks and shareable occasions.

Doug Hall, senior director of business development at Raybern’s, said the sliders build on the brand’s frozen sandwich platform in an easier-to-eat, shareable format.

Raybern’s wholesale foodservice products may be available through Vendor’s Supply or authorized distributors, and operators can contact Raybern’s directly to confirm availability in their market.
